The "Japanese ethos" in game design differs dramatically from the Western "simulation" model. While Western studios often chase hyper-realism and player freedom (sandboxes), Japanese developers—specifically those like Hideo Kojima or FromSoftware—champion curated difficulty, surrealism, and "game feel." The success of Elden Ring or The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om proves that players still crave the specific friction and whimsy that only Japanese designers provide.
Japan's vibrant otaku (geek) culture has played a significant role in shaping the country's entertainment industry. The devotion of fans to specific anime, manga, and video game franchises has created a lucrative market for merchandise, conventions, and themed events.
